2007 BMW 328 vs. 1977 Seat 124

To start off, 2007 BMW 328 is newer by 30 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1977 Seat 124.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1977 Seat 124 would be higher. At 3,001 cc (6 cylinders), 2007 BMW 328 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 BMW 328 (230 HP @ 6500 RPM) has 118 more horse power than 1977 Seat 124. (112 HP @ 6000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2007 BMW 328 should accelerate faster than 1977 Seat 124.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2007 BMW 328 weights approximately 535 kg more than 1977 Seat 124.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 2007 BMW 328 (271 Nm @ 2750 RPM) has 120 more torque (in Nm) than 1977 Seat 124. (151 Nm @ 4000 RPM). This means 2007 BMW 328 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1977 Seat 124.
